About the role

Ryder is hiring a Warehouse Automation Technician in Newnan, Georgia. This position offers weekly pay, excellent benefits, and a career path that prioritizes safety and continuous improvement.

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ot and repair warehouse automation systems, including conveyor systems, auto storage and retrieval systems, auto guided vehicles, and other electrical and control systems.
  • Perform preventative and corrective maintenance work orders as assigned.
  • Conduct root cause and failure analysis on major equipment downtime events, collaborate with site engineering and management, and implement corrective actions to prevent reoccurrence.
  • Utilize computerized maintenance management systems to organize the department and communicate effectively with the plant and corporate management.
  • Maintain and ensure spare parts inventories and/or consignment inventories are consistent with procedures.
  • Participate in safety and Lean programs, supporting the Ryder culture.
  • Ensure a clean and organized maintenance area, making the facility tour-ready.
  • Participate in the continual development and improvement of maintenance policies, procedures, and standard operating procedures for the facility.

Requirements

  • Vocational or Technical certification in related field or 5 years of relevant experience (in lieu of certification).
  • 5 years or more experience with maintenance repair and preventative maintenance on warehouse automation equipment.
  • 2 years or more experience with connecting to programmable logic controllers (PLCs) for troubleshooting equipment issues.
  • 5 years or more experience performing maintenance on high voltage (480v) equipment and AC/DC motors or components.
  • 2 years or more experience using automation warehouse execution systems (WES) to ensure proper communication and messaging between WES and warehouse management systems (WMS).
  • Two (2) years or more experience using machine level HMI screens or machine level control systems to diagnose machine faults and validate inputs and outputs from the field back to the PLCs.
  • Knowledge of 480 volts and pneumatic equipment.
  • Expertise in computer-based equipment maintenance and parts inventory systems.
  • Demonstrated independent problem-solving capability.
  • Expertise in PLC and HMI Programming software, specifically Allen Bradley, Ignition, and Wonderware.
  • Expertise in 24VDC Control systems, photoelectric & proximity sensors.
  • Experience with programming/troubleshooting Servo and Stepper motors and related software.
  • Experience with programming/troubleshooting Bar Code Scanners and other Vision Systems, specifically Cognex, Datalogic, Keyence, etc.
  • Knowledge of operating MHE to include by not limited to: Forklift, Scissor Lift, Boom Lift, etc.
  • Ability to work independently in a safe manner, including working at heights.
  • Knowledge of warehouse maintenance safety procedures, including but not limited to: Lock Out Tag Out, Fall Restraint, and Forklift/MHE Operational Safety.
  • Ability to troubleshoot/program Bar Code Scanners and other Vision Systems, Specifically Cognex, Datalogic, Keyence, etc.
